A Medical Device In Star Trek Is A Real Thing Now

The Scanadu Scout, a Medical Device or something like the medical tricorder from Star Trek which scans the person’s vital signs. It can read your blood pressure, heart rate, oxygen levels, respiratory rate, and body temperature when you will place against your forehead.

Not only this, it also sends this report to your smartphone so that you can upload it to your doctor, or even your Facebook profile.

Scout is expected to come in market upto March, 2014, as currently it is in the process of getting FDA approval.
